Market Overview

The Global Food Colours Market will grow from USD 4.12 Billion in 2025 to USD 6.18 Billion by 2031 at a 6.99% CAGR. The Global Food Colours Market consists of substances intended to impart or restore the hue of consumable products, encompassing natural extracts, synthetic compounds, and nature identical materials. The primary drivers sustaining this industry include the rising global consumption of processed convenience foods and the psychological influence of product aesthetics on consumer flavor perception. According to the Centre for the Promotion of Imports, in 2024, the European food additives market was estimated to be valued at 11.7 billion euros, highlighting the substantial economic scale of the sector utilizing these ingredients.

However, market expansion is frequently hindered by the complexity of international regulatory compliance. Differing legal standards for permissible colorants between regions, such as the European Union and North America, create reformulation burdens for manufacturers aiming for global distribution. This regulatory inconsistency imposes significant costs and operational delays, thereby challenging the seamless scalability of food colour products across international borders.

Key Market Drivers

Rising consumer preference for natural and clean-label ingredients is fundamentally reshaping the Global Food Colours Market. As health-conscious shoppers increasingly scrutinize product labels for artificial additives, manufacturers are rapidly substituting synthetic dyes with plant-based alternatives derived from fruits, vegetables, and edible plants. This transition is driven by the demand for transparency and the psychological association of natural hues with nutritional quality, forcing brands to reformulate iconic products to maintain consumer trust without compromising visual appeal. The scale of this shift is evident in the performance of major natural color suppliers. According to Food Engineering & Ingredients, October 2024, in the 'GNT achieves 26% carbon reduction at EXBERRY colour production facilities' article, global sales of the GNT Group's plant-based EXBERRY colours have increased by more than 50% since 2020, underscoring the aggressive industrial adoption of non-artificial pigmentation solutions.

The expansion of the global processed and packaged food industry further propels market growth, creating sustained demand for colorants that ensure product consistency and stability. As urbanization and changing lifestyles fuel the consumption of ready-to-eat meals, beverages, and confectionery, food colours are essential for correcting natural variations and enhancing the aesthetic allure of mass-produced items. This industrial demand provides a massive revenue base for color manufacturers. According to FoodDrinkEurope, January 2025, in the 'Data & Trends 2024' report, the European food and drink industry generated a turnover of €1.2 trillion, highlighting the immense volume of processed goods requiring additive solutions. Consequently, leading color specialists are capitalizing on this volume; according to Sensient Technologies, in 2024, the company's Color Group reported revenue of $647.9 million, reflecting the sector's significant financial footprint.

Key Market Challenges

The Global Food Colours Market is significantly impeded by the complexity of international regulatory compliance. As manufacturers attempt to distribute products across borders, they encounter a fragmented legal landscape where permissible colorants in one jurisdiction, such as the European Union, may be restricted or banned in another, like North America. This disparity necessitates the creation of multiple product formulations for different markets, fundamentally disrupting economies of scale. Instead of maintaining a streamlined global supply chain, companies are forced to invest heavily in region-specific research and development, which drains financial resources and extends the time-to-market for new launches.

This regulatory inconsistency acts as a direct brake on industry growth by introducing operational volatility and financial risk. The burden of tracking and adhering to shifting legal standards diverts capital away from innovation and market expansion efforts. According to the American Bakers Association, in 2024, the proliferation of distinct state-level bans on specific additives and colors in the United States forced manufacturers to conduct extensive formulation audits to avoid non-compliance penalties of up to $10,000 per violation. Such compliance hurdles compel companies to prioritize defensive regulatory management over proactive growth strategies, thereby stalling the seamless scalability of food colour products in the international arena.

Key Market Trends

The Commercial Scale-Up of Precision Fermentation-Derived Colorants is fundamentally altering the supply chain by offering stable, bio-identical pigments that bypass the volatility of agricultural sourcing. Manufacturers are increasingly investing in biotechnology to produce high-performance hues, particularly reds and blues, which historically struggle with stability in plant-based formats. This shift allows for the creation of vegan, kosher, and halal-certified colors that maintain vibrancy across varying pH levels and temperatures, directly addressing the limitations of insect-derived carmine or heat-sensitive vegetable extracts. The industrial viability of this technology is evidenced by significant capital inflows aimed at regulatory approval and mass production; according to Protein Production Technology International, November 2025, in the 'Chromologics secures €7 million to advance fermentation-derived natural colors toward market launch' article, the biotech firm Chromologics raised €7 million to finalize regulatory submissions and commercialize its novel fermentation-derived red pigment, Natu.Red.

The Transition from Regulated Additives to Coloring Foodstuffs and Concentrates is accelerating as companies reformulate to meet stringent clean-label standards and preempt legislative bans on synthetic dyes. Unlike selective extraction, coloring foodstuffs are processed using mild physical methods, allowing them to be labeled as ingredients rather than additives, which appeals to health-conscious consumers and simplifies cross-border compliance. This migration is driving substantial financial growth for suppliers capable of delivering high-volume natural solutions that match the visual intensity of artificial counterparts. Highlighting this financial momentum, according to Sensient Technologies, February 2025, in the 'Sensient Technologies Corporation Reports Results for the Quarter Ended December 31, 2024' report, the company's Color Group generated a revenue of $158.1 million in the fourth quarter alone, a growth driven primarily by higher volumes in natural color product lines.

Segmental Insights

The Food & Beverages segment currently stands as the fastest-growing category within the Global Food Colours Market. This rapid expansion is primarily driven by escalating consumer demand for visually appealing processed foods, carbonated drinks, and functional beverages. As lifestyles become busier, there is a marked shift toward packaged ready-to-eat products that rely on high-quality colorants to enhance product attractiveness. Furthermore, the industry is witnessing a significant transition toward natural colorants to meet clean-label requirements. This growth is reinforced by strict adherence to safety standards established by regulatory bodies like the U.S. Food and Drug Administration (FDA), ensuring consumer confidence in these additives.

Regional Insights

Europe holds the leading position in the Global Food Colours Market, driven by a combination of strict regulatory oversight and high consumer awareness. The European Food Safety Authority (EFSA) mandates rigorous safety evaluations, which has accelerated the industry-wide shift from synthetic dyes toward natural alternatives. This regulatory environment supports a robust demand for clean-label ingredients within the region's extensive food and beverage processing sector. As manufacturers reformulate products to meet these transparency standards, the European market continues to expand through the increased adoption of natural and organic colour solutions.

Recent Developments

  • In September 2024, Oterra launched a new range of natural color solutions called I-Colors Bold, designed to deliver intense and vibrant hues previously difficult to achieve with natural ingredients. The new line featured ten ultra-fine milled powders, including a vivid red derived from sweet potato that could compete with synthetic lakes in terms of visual impact. Oterra designed these colors for use in applications such as snack seasonings, compound coatings, and bakery fillings, where they offered better dispersion and uniformity. The company emphasized that this innovation would allow manufacturers to meet clean-label requirements while maintaining the bold aesthetics that consumers expect.
  • In July 2024, GNT Group announced a strategic expansion into fermentation technology to develop new sustainable color solutions, marking a shift from its traditional fruit and vegetable-based methods. To support this initiative, the company entered into a collaboration with Plume Biotechnology, a startup specializing in fermentation science. This partnership aimed to create high-performance, plant-based color ingredients that could be produced efficiently year-round, regardless of agricultural seasonality. GNT Group stated that this move would enhance its EXBERRY portfolio with future-proof options that deliver improved functionality and sustainability for food and beverage manufacturers.
  • In July 2024, Lycored debuted a new nature-based colorant named ResilientRed BF at the IFT FIRST Annual Event and Expo. Sourced from tomatoes, this clean-label ingredient was designed to provide stability and resistance to extreme pH, light, and heat conditions, making it suitable for challenging applications such as UHT dairy, plant-based meat alternatives, and surimi seafood. The company highlighted that ResilientRed BF offered improved viscosity for easier processing and delivered vibrant red shades at lower dosages. This launch addressed the growing consumer demand for natural, "free-from" ingredients without compromising on performance or visual appeal in processed foods.
  • In February 2024, Phytolon and Ginkgo Bioworks achieved a significant technical milestone in their ongoing collaboration to produce natural food colors via precision fermentation. The partnership successfully optimized yeast strains to produce the full spectrum of betalain pigments, ranging from yellow to purple, which offered a sustainable alternative to synthetic dyes. This development allowed the companies to enhance the production efficiency of these cell-engineered colors, making them more cost-competitive for industrial applications. The breakthrough paved the way for Phytolon to scale its manufacturing capabilities and move closer to commercializing its vibrant, animal-free food colorants for the global market.
